#35983f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#35983f is composed of 20.8% red, 59.6%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.6%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 126.1 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 40.2%. #35983f color hex could be obtained by blending #6aff7e with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#35983f color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#35983f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#35983f has RGB values of R:53, G:152,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3512383.

Shades and Tints of #35983f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020703 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#35983f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646965 is the less saturated color, while #06c719 is the most saturated one.
